Cross-Cultural Differences in Temperament: Comparing Paternal ratings of US and Dutch infants

Insights

US and Dutch fathers show distinct infant temperament ratings. US fathers reported higher Surgency and Negative Emotionality, while Dutch fathers reported higher falling reactivity, highlighting cultural differences in early development.

Area of Science:

  • Developmental Psychology
  • Cross-Cultural Psychology
  • Infant Behavior

Background:

  • Cultural variations in parenting and child development are increasingly recognized.
  • Previous research has indicated differences in temperament ratings between Dutch mothers and US mothers.
  • Understanding paternal perspectives on infant temperament across cultures is crucial for a comprehensive view of child development.

Purpose of the Study:

  • To conduct a longitudinal comparison of US and Dutch paternal temperament ratings of infants.
  • To investigate cultural differences in specific infant temperament traits as perceived by fathers.
  • To examine culture-by-age and culture-by-gender interactions in paternal temperament ratings.

Main Methods:

  • Longitudinal study comparing US and Dutch fathers' ratings of infant temperament.
  • Utilized the Infant Behaviour Questionnaire-Revised (IBQ-R) at 4 and 12 months of age.
  • Sample sizes: 4 months (US n=99; Dutch n=127), 12 months (US n=66; Dutch n=112).

Main Results:

  • US fathers rated infants higher in Surgency (vocal reactivity, high-intensity pleasure, activity level) and Negative Emotionality (sadness, distress to limitations, fear).
  • Dutch fathers rated infants higher in falling reactivity.
  • Differences were also observed in Orienting/regulatory capacity, with US infants rated higher in duration of orienting and lower in soothability. Significant culture-by-age and culture-by-gender interactions were found.

Conclusions:

  • Paternal ratings reveal significant cultural differences in infant temperament between US and Dutch fathers.
  • These findings align with previous research on maternal ratings, suggesting robust cultural influences on temperament perception.
  • The study underscores the importance of considering cultural context in understanding early temperament development, even between seemingly similar Western cultures.

Cross-Sectional Research

In cross-sectional research, a researcher compares multiple segments of the population at the same time. If they were interested in people's dietary habits, the researcher might directly compare different groups of people by age.
